Soybean (Yellow)黄大豆 · Kidaizu · ถั่วเหลืองญี่ปุ่น

Soy isoflavones regulate estrogen receptors while lecithin supports nervous system and memory integrity.

Overview

Complete plant protein with isoflavones and lecithin for hormonal stability and cognitive health.

  • Origin: Japan
  • Standard portion: 100 g
  • Approx. 422 kcal per serving

Nutrition facts label

Amount: 100 gLabel serving size: 100 g
Calories422 kcal
NutrientAdult % DV
Nutrition facts for selected amount
NutrientAmount · Adult % DV
Protein35.3 g71% of adult daily value
Net Carbs28.2 g10% of adult daily value
Fat19 g24% of adult daily value
Fiber
Sodium1 mg0% of adult daily value
Total Carbs28.2 g10% of adult daily value
Sugar
Potassium1900 mg40% of adult daily value
Phosphorus540 mg43% of adult daily value
Iron9.4 mg52% of adult daily value
Calcium180 mg14% of adult daily value
Isoflavone140 mg
Thiamine0.8 mg

Percent daily values are based on standard adult recommended intake.
